      As you can imagine cell repair is vital for keeping the body functioning well. Some white blood cells, like macrophages that you mentioned earlier, are really good at cleaning up the mess from dead and injured cells, this makes sure that repair of the tissues can occur quickly and without too much more inflammation being made from the dead and injured cells.

      Some scientists think that without a proper clean up you can be at risk for developing autoimmune diseases, where your white blood cells mistakenly attack the body rather than germs.

      I was always amazed by how our body can mend itself so well after damage or disease, whether it’s from a virus or a broken leg. I’m still impressed by the way there are all these cells that have specific jobs that fit perfectly with each other and that they communicate with each other to coordinate the whole healing process. But even though this system is good, it’s not perfect. Some injuries like brain injuries or spine injuries we can’t recover as well from, which is why people who are paralysed or mentally disabled often are for the the rest of their lives. So I got interested in why cells in the brain and spine aren’t as good at growing back and fixing themselves, and whether there is anything that we can do that can help the cells recover.

      Brain cells are some of the most important cells in the brain and different ones control different things like memories, movement, sight, hearing. If these cells get damaged we can lose some of these functions and people become disabled in a variety of ways. If we find out how the cells get damaged we can try and come up with drugs which prevent that damage happening and then when people have a stroke, develop a disease or get a head injury, if we give the drugs quickly enough we might be able to stop the damage occuring.

      I am specifically interested in egg cells and how they get damaged when the women gets older. These dodgy eggs mean that a lot of women find it hard to get pregnant when they are a bit older or they have a higher chance of having children with conditions like Downs syndrome.

      By the time the women is about 40 the eggs are very old and start making mistakes and ending up with the wrong number of chromosomes. The chromosomes carry the DNA which is the instructions for making the body – so if you have the wrong number of chromosomes the body gets confused and doesnt know which instructions to follow.

      We think that old eggs are a bit dodgy as they are missing a special molecule which normally helps them to maintain the correct number of chromosomes.Our idea is if we can put this special molecule back into the dodgy eggs from older women to make the eggs healthier. We hope this will then allow the women to have healthy children. The reason I think this is a really interesting topic is because nowadays women often want to have a career first so have babies when they are a bit older.
